Added project cppunittest to examples/: unit tests to test cppunit.
added project cppunittest to examples/: unit tests to test cppunit. The main file is CppUnitTestMain.cpp. Unit tests have been implemented for TestCaller and TestListener. * added project CppUnitTestApp to examples/msvc6: graphical runner for cppunittest. * added TestListener to TestResult. It is a port of junit TestListener. * updated some .cvsignore to ignore files generated with VC++.
